Handover: Payroll export change, Tallowbridge build. Effective next cycle, the Ledgerline export drops fixed-width and moves to pipe-delimited CSV. Column order changed: employee ref now precedes cost center. Support will see tickets about rejected uploads from clients still on the old parser — point them to the migration note in the Ledgerline help center. Old format stays readable until end of quarter. Marta owns the converter script; I own schema questions until Friday. To unlock the archived export vault, use the passphrase below.

strongbox words: praath-queniel-holax-druael-jorath-noveth-druok

The Orvane Labs bike cage and the east and west parking gates operate on separate access schedules, and facilities desk staff should note that visitor vehicles may only use the west gate between 07:00 and 19:00. Cyclists requesting cage access must show a valid day pass, and their details should be entered in the access ledger before the cage is opened. Gates must never be propped open, even briefly, during deliveries. When a manual override is required at either gate, use the code below.

staff pass of fadup-fawig = bdg-FUNKS-4

## Night Shift — Prototype Workshop (Building C)

Workshop is off-limits 22:00–05:00 unless a Tollgate Labs run is scheduled. Check the run board first. Machines stay powered down; extraction fans on if resin is curing. Log every entry in the night book by the door. Do not prop the door. When entry is authorised, use the door code below.

staff pass of kagup-fajog = bdg-QCHVQW-99665837